Optimization of extraction technology of sterols from discarded soybean pod by response surface methodology

The ethanol solution extraction of sterols from discarded soybean pod was studied. The effects of factors on sterols yield was investigated by single factor experiment. On this basis, liquid to material ratio, ethanol concentration, extraction time and extraction temperature were selected, response surface method was used to optimize the extraction process of sterols. The model between extraction conditions and yield was established and analyzed for obtaining the optimal technological parameters and improve the sterols yield. The results showed that the sterols yield was significantly affected by the above four selected factors. The model obtained was significant. The optimum technological conditions of the ethanol extraction of soybean pod sterols were the liquid to material ratio of 26.8 mL g-1, ethanol concentration of 72.4%, extracting time of 1.86 h, extraction temperature of 68.4 °C. The theoretical maximum sterols yield was 7.82 mg g-1, the actual sterols yield was 7.74 mg g-1.
